SERVICE ADJUSTMENT PROCEDURES
WIPE#l BLADE RUBBER REPLACEMENT
WINdSHIELD WIPER
NOBKIAA
1. Pull out the rubber and backing blade from the stopper
side.
Back&g blade
2. Remove the backing blade from the rubber.
3. To attach a new rubber, assemble the rubber and backing
blade, insert from the direction opposite the stopper, and
secure by the stopper. Note that, because the backing
blade is curved, installation should be as shown in the
figure.
REAR WIPER
1. Pull out one side of the wiper blade rubber from the
stopper.
2. Pull out the wiper blade rubber, and then remove the blade
rubber.
3. Installation of the new blade rubber is the reverse
procedure of removal.

SERVICE POINTS OF REMOVAL
5. WIPER MOTOR
Uncouple the linkage and motor (with the wiper motor
pulled slightly outward).
Caution
Because the installation position of the crank arm and the
motor determine the wiper auto stop angle, do not disas-
semble them unless it is necessary to do so. If the crank arm
must be removed from the motor, remove it only after
marking their mounting positions.

INSPECTION
WIPER MOTOR
Disconnect the wiring connector from the wiper motor and
connect battery to the wiper motor connector to check that
the @viper motor runs.
LOW SPEED OPERATION CHECK
Connect battery ( + ) to terminal 1 and battery ( - ) to terminal 3
and check that the motor runs at low speed.
HIGH SPEEID OPERATION CHECK
Connect battery (+) to terminal 1 and battery (-) to terminal 4
and check that the motor runs at high speed.
AUTOMATIC STOP OPERATION CHECK
(1) Connect battery ( +) to terminal 1 and battery ( -) to
terminal 3 to run the motor at low speed.
(2) Disconnect terminal 1 during operation to stop the motor.
